Why Does It Matter?
Commercial auto insurance is designed specifically for vehicles used in business activities, offering broader coverage and higher limits to address the risks a business may face while delivering goods or visiting clients. In addition, Georgia law requires businesses to carry minimum liability coverage for commercial vehicles.
What Does It Cover?

In general, a commercial auto insurance policy offers coverage for the following:
- Losses caused by colliding with another vehicle or an object
- Damage caused by natural disasters, fire, theft and vandalism
- Third-party medical and other expenses if an employee is liable for causing bodily injuries to another person while operating a company-owned or leased vehicle
- Expenses related to causing damage to someone else’s property
- Your losses if a vehicle is hit by an at-fault driver with inadequate liability coverage
How Much Does a Policy Cost?
The cost of a commercial auto policy can be influenced by several factors. These may include, but are not limited to:
- Employees’ driving records
- Claims history
- Location
- Fleet characteristics (e.g., make, model, year, value)
- Deductible
- Coverage selection
